stainless steel acid etching involves using acid to selectively remove layers of the surface of stainless steel, creating detailed designs and patterns. This precise technique allows artists and craftsmen to create unique pieces that showcase the beauty and versatility of stainless steel.

The process of stainless steel acid etching begins with preparing the metal surface. The stainless steel is thoroughly cleaned and degreased to ensure that the acid can effectively penetrate the metal. A resist material such as vinyl, wax, or a special acid-resistant film is then applied to the areas of the metal that are to be protected from the acid. This resist material acts as a stencil, allowing the artist to control which parts of the metal are etched and which are left untouched.

Next, the stainless steel is immersed in an acid solution. The most commonly used acid for etching stainless steel is ferric chloride, a powerful and corrosive substance that eats away at the unprotected metal. The length of time the metal is left in the acid bath determines the depth of the etching, with longer exposure resulting in deeper cuts.

One of the key advantages of stainless steel acid etching is the level of precision it offers. Unlike other forms of metalwork that rely on carving or engraving tools, acid etching allows for incredibly fine details and intricate patterns to be created. This level of control and precision makes stainless steel acid etching a popular choice for creating custom designs, logos, and decorative elements on a wide range of stainless steel products.

In addition to its precision, stainless steel acid etching also offers a high level of repeatability. Once a design has been created and the resist material applied, multiple pieces can be etched with identical patterns. This makes stainless steel acid etching an efficient and cost-effective option for producing large quantities of custom metal pieces.

The versatility of stainless steel acid etching is further enhanced by the ability to create a variety of finishes. By adjusting the type of resist material used, the concentration of the acid solution, and the length of time the metal is etched, artisans can achieve a wide range of effects. From glossy and reflective surfaces to matte and textured finishes, stainless steel acid etching offers endless possibilities for creative expression.

Stainless steel acid etching is not only used for decorative purposes but also serves practical applications. The process can be used to add serial numbers, identification marks, or safety warnings to stainless steel components without compromising the integrity of the metal. This makes stainless steel acid etching a valuable tool for manufacturers looking to ensure product traceability and compliance with industry standards.
